Mark Thomas
This place is busy! 11:30 a.m. on a Tuesday. The parking lot is seriously full (Detroit P.D. in one of them), maybe 6 spaces empty and inside only a couple of small (2 seat) tables/booths plus about 5-6 seats at the counter. I’m calling that a good sign, folks.
Despite all those existing customers, I was greeted before I could get to the “Please Wait to be Seated” sign.
The menu is fairly large, the breakfast offerings taking up one whole side. So many decisions! There is a small kids menu in one corner but it’s mostly smaller portions for the wee ones.
Server took my order almost as fast as I could decide, and smiling every time I saw her. Went with a Gyro Supreme ($8.99) and got it about 3 minutes later, hot and delicious. Props to the cooks, too. A well constructed gyro. Often the meat is strewn right down the middle of the pita which becomes the bottom so you only get meat or veg in your bite. This was well offset so I got meat in nearly every bite. Kudos!
